    What is sandblasting?

    Sandblasting is a process in which high-pressure air is used to blast sand onto a surface. This can be done for a variety of purposes, such as removing paint or rust, or preparing a surface for painting. Sandblasting is also commonly used to clean stone surfaces like brick or concrete. The sandblasting process can be quite messy, so it’s important to make sure that you have all the necessary safety equipment before starting. In addition, you’ll need to have a good supply of sand on hand, as well as a way to dispose of the used sand afterwards. But with the right preparation, sandblasting can be an effective way to clean or prepare any number of surfaces.

    How does a sandblaster work?

    A sandblaster is a very useful tool that can be used for a variety of different projects. Whether you’re trying to remove paint from a wood surface, or you need to clean up rust from metal, a sandblaster can get the job done quickly and easily. There are a few different types of sandblasters available on the market, and each one has its own set of benefits. Gravity feed sandblasters are some of the most popular, because they’re very easy to use. They work by using gravity to pull the abrasive material through the nozzle and onto the surface that you’re trying to clean. Pressure fed sandblasters are also popular, because they’re very powerful and can blast away tough materials like paint and rust. If you need to clean something delicate, like glass, then you may want to consider using a suction fed sandblaster.

    These sandblasters work by using suction to pull the abrasive material through the nozzle, which makes them ideal for delicate surfaces. No matter what type of project you’re working on, there’s a sandblaster out there that can help you get it done quickly and easily.

    How to prepare a surface for sandblasting and what safety precautions should be taken?

    It can be dangerous if not done properly, so it’s important to take some safety precautions before starting. First, you need to make sure that the area you’re working in is well ventilated. Second, you need to wear proper safety gear, including a respirator and protective clothing. Finally, you need to make sure that the surface you’re sandblasting is properly prepared. This means removing all loose debris and covering any areas that you don’t want sandblasted. Once you’ve taken these precautions, you’re ready to start sandblasting.
